Which country has the highest number of active volcanoes?
Indonesia has the highest number of active volcanoes in the world. There are over 130 active volcanoes in Indonesia, which is located in the Pacific Ring of Fire, a region known for its volcanic and seismic activity. The Ring of Fire is a horseshoe-shaped region that runs along the edges of the Pacific Ocean, from the west coast of North and South America to Japan and Indonesia.
Indonesia's most active volcano is Mount Merapi, which has erupted more than 70 times in the last 500 years. Other active volcanoes in Indonesia include Mount Sinabung, Mount Agung, and Anak Krakatau. The eruptions of these volcanoes can have a significant impact on the local population, including displacement and economic losses.
